Object Details

Artist

Patrick Henry Bruce, American, b. Campbell County, Virginia, 1881–1936

Provenance

The Artist
Henri Pierre Roche, Paris, 1933-1959
Mme. Henri Pierre Roche, 1959-1965
M. Knoedler, New York (on consignment), 1965-1967
Noah Goldowsky Gallery, New York, 1967
Josephine Cockrell Thornton, Washington, DC, from 1967
Joseph H. Hirshhorn, Washington, DC. by 1980?-31 August 1981
Estate of Joseph H. Hirshhorn, 1981-1986
Joseph H. Hirshhorn Bequest, 1981
